Layer 06

Il cloaking cos'è

Agent Name Tutti i browser hanno un nome e anche gli spider dei motori di ricerca. Per esempio quello di Altavista è chiamato “Scooter” Sapendo questo, inviare una pagina diversa a seconda del nome è piuttosto semplice. Si deve utilizzare qualche script da parte server che controlla il nome e si comporta di conseguenza. Qualcosa del tipo: Se Agent Name è uguale a A o B o C, servi pagina A altrimenti servi pagina B Il problema di questo approccio però, è che si può falsificare facilmente il nome che il browser manda al server, pertanto non è bene utilizzare questa tecnica se si vuole tenere il codice della pagina segreto il più possibile. Per una lista dei nomi degli spider http://fantomaster.com/. Indirizzo IP L’indirizzo IP è l’indirizzo numerico che identifica i nodi collegati alla rete. Tutti hanno un indirizzo IP quando sono su Internet, e pertanto anche gli spider. Il metodo è analogo al precedente, l’unica differenza è che invece di controllare l’agent name lo script controllerà l’IP. Purtroppo però le cose sono molto più complesse in quanto di deve mantenere un’enorme lista di indirizzi IP. Inoltre, questi indirizzi possono cambiare e nuovi IP essere aggiunti. l grande vantaggio è che diventa impossibile per ognuno vedere il codice presentato ai motori. Per una lista di indirizzi IP conosciuti, visitate http://www.spiderhunter.com.]]>